Output a39abe01f5fd4c19fcd7865b02ea3f114eb6db697093bd8ba60a249be7e2d367:2

value
584704874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9485668b74d586b35fd439333aaaacbbc3ce9fbb OP_EQUAL
address
3FEKjmXGjRYk9h842zbjxczp7UbSfhLwpk
transaction
a39abe01f5fd4c19fcd7865b02ea3f114eb6db697093bd8ba60a249be7e2d367
confirmations
571351
spent
true